Environmental and Engineering Services: Building Climate Adaptation Into Statewide Greenhouse Gas Toolkit - CAPCOA GHG Handbook Update
RFP No. 2020-002
Sacramento Metropolitan Air Quality Management District
Sacramento, Sacramento County, CA
04/24/2020 at 01:00
The purpose of this RFP is to solicit bids from qualified entities with in-depth expertise in greenhouse gas (GHG) and air quality modeling, climate mitigation, and climate adaptation. The selected contractor will support the District to implement a SB1 Adaptation Planning Grant by providing environmental and engineering services to build climate adaptation into a statewide GHG toolkit. The selected Contractor will be responsible for developing a new version of California Air Pollution Control Officers Association's (CAPCOA) Quantifying Greenhouse Gas Mitigation Measures, A Resource for Local Government to Assess Emission Reductions from Greenhouse Gas Mitigation Measures (August 2010) (GHG Handbook).
